one The National Debt Register (PRC) is also to be new. It will replace the practically useless register of insolvent KRS debtors and marginalise the role of Judicial and Economic Monitor (MSiG)
The purpose of the CRS is to:
- • creating better conditions for the exit of economic operators from difficult economic situations;
- • to prevent the paralysis of restructuring and bankruptcy courts linked to the increase in the number of cases pending;
- • improving the functioning of restructuring and bankruptcy courts;
- • improving restructuring and bankruptcy proceedings;
- • allow access to bankruptcy and restructuring information to creditors, courts and other interested persons residing or established in other EU Member States;
- • creation one a register for all entities that are insolvent or in difficulty.
The new system will publish information on the submission of a restructuring application or an application for bankruptcy; lists and lists of receivables, condition and composition of the bankruptcy, as well as on-going information on the stage at which the proceedings are conducted.
